Attachment <br />Proposed Sustainability-Related Zoning Code Changes <br />67 c.Lighting. Site lighting shall be provided where EVSE is installed, unless charging <br />68 is for daytime purposes only. <br />69 d.Equipment Design Standards. <br />70 i.Battery charging station outlets and connector devices shall be mounted to <br />71 comply with state code and must comply with all relevant Americans with <br />72 Disabilities Act (ADA) requirements. Equipment mounted on pedestals, <br />73 lighting posts, bollards, or other devices shall be designed and located as <br />74 to not impede pedestrian travel or create trip hazards on sidewalks. <br />75 ii.Electric vehicle charging devices may be located adjacent to designated <br />76 parking spaces in a garage or parking lot as long as the devices do not <br />77 encroach into the required dimensions of the parking space (length, width, <br />78 and height clearances). <br />79 iii.The design should be appropriate to the location and use. Facilities should <br />80 be able to be readily identified by electric vehicle users and blend into the <br />81 surrounding landscape/architecture for compatibility with the character <br />82 and use of the site. <br />83 iv.EVCS pedestals shall be designed to minimize potential damage by <br />84 accidents, vandalism and to be safe for use in inclement weather. <br />85 e.Usage Fees. The property owner may collect a service fee for the use of EVSE. <br />86 f.Maintenance. EVSE shall be maintained in all respects, including the functioning <br />87 of the equipment. A phone number or other contact information shall be provided <br />88 on the equipment for reporting problems with the equipment or access to it. <br />89 <br />90 2) Definitions Related to Electric Vehicle Charging and Shoreland Standards <br />91 1001.10 Definitions <br />92 NEW ELECTRIC VEHICLE CHARGING DEFINITIONS <br />93 ACCESSIBLE ELECTRIC VEHICLE CHARGING STATION: electric vehicle charging station <br />94 where the battery charging station is located within accessible reach of a barrier-free access aisle <br />95 and the electric vehicle. <br />96 BATTERY CHARGING STATION: means an electrical component, assembly or cluster of <br />97 component assemblies designed specifically to charge batteries within electric vehicles. <br />98 BATTERY ELECTRIC VEHICLE: any vehicle that operates exclusively on electrical energy <br />99 from an off-board source that is stored in the vehicle’s batteries and produces zero tailpipe <br />100 emissions or pollution when stationary or operating. <br />101 CHARGING LEVELS: standardized indicators of electrical force, or voltage, at which an <br />102 electric vehicle’s battery is recharged.
